Dr. Arnold Peter Weiss is a renowned hand surgeon currently serving as a Professor and Vice Chairman within Brown University's Warren Alpert Medical School. He is recognized internationally as an accomplished hand surgeon with University Orthopedics. He is also the Chief of the Division of Hand, Upper Extremity & Microvascular surgery at
Rhode Island Hospital and Brown University.
He began his studies at The University of Michigan before being accepted into a prestigious B.A.-M.D. program at Johns Hopkins University, where he, in turn, earned his medical degree. He has worked with Brown University for a number of years, teaching courses on the Business of Medicine and acting as Assistant and then Dean of Admissions for the medical school.
Dr. Arnold Peter Weiss has performed over 30,000 surgeries for patients all over the world. He has treated patients in nearly all 50 states within the U.S. and has served many international patients as well. His success did not stop with surgery, as he also created several medical devices still used to this day both in the United States and internationally.

Recently, Dr. Arnold Peter Weiss was awarded the Weiland Medal for Outstanding Lifetime Research in Hand Surgery at the American Society for Surgery of the Hand meeting held in Boston, MA. In addition to receiving his award, he also gave eight different lectures on hand surgery, served on three different panels for instructional courses, and ran two major symposiums discussing business and innovation in the healthcare industry. This was a true career highlight and achievement for Dr. Weiss.
Arnold Peter Weiss is also a member of multiple professional societies, including Johns Hopkins Medical & Surgical Society, American Academy of Orthopaedic Surgeons, American Society for Surgery of the Hand, Indianapolis Hand Society, New Millennium Hand Study Group, Orthopaedic Research Society, New England Hand Society, and the American Orthopaedic Association.
